A large set of twelve displaying porcelain plates with surrealism designs by Piero Fornasetti for Rosenthal, an iconic series from 'Temi e variazioni' (“Themes and Variations”). These plates were made for displaying on the wall not for daily use and there are loop holes on the back for easy hanging. They are vintage pieces with gilt on the edge of the plates and different from the current productions. This collection was inspired by the renowned soprano vocalist, Lina Cavalieri, who was invented and depicted the lady 'Julia.' in various composition. Marked on the bottom of each plate with [Rosenthal, Germany/Fornasetti/Dekor: Temi e variazioni] and also the plates ('Motiv') number: 16, 17, 19, 20, 24, 25, 26, 27, 28, 29, 34 and 36.
